Curtis, Neb. – “Low to High Tech Water Solutions” will the theme for the 2016 irrigation management forum to be hosted at the University of Nebraska College of Technical Agriculture in Curtis on Jan. 28.

 “The workshop targets crop producers and irrigation management – choosing tools that work for their specific operations,” said Brad Ramsdale, PhD, agronomy and agricultural mechanics division chairman. “Our NCTA agronomy students will be joining irrigators and crop producers in receiving excellent management information.”

 Irrigation and technology companies will display the latest in water management resources, said Roric Paulman, a Sutherland, Neb., producer and industry advocate. Paulman is chairman of the Nebraska Water Balance Alliance, event co-host with NCTA and the University of Nebraska’s West Central Research and Extension Center.

 “Every farm operation is unique and this workshop will emphasize how irrigators can use various management tools,” Paulman said. “Some may be simple but very workable, low-tech strategies while others may be quite sophisticated.”

 Information will include producer panels and success stories, break-out sessions, research trials, and discussions on technology from sprinkler packages to use of satellite imagery for field management, said Ramsdale.

 The event is complementary for attendees, but pre-registration is required by Jan. 21 to guarantee a noon meal.
